Capstone Asset Management's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Capstone Asset Management held 1,690 positions worth $3.47B, down 2% from $3.54B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 9.3% of the portfolio.

Capstone Asset Management's Q2 2015 filing shows 39 new, 637 increased, 922 reduced and 77 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F: 67,111 shares worth $2.66M. The largest sale was State Street Financial Select Sector SPDR ETF, an estimated $19.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 17% of assets, up from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
